Mar 22, 2011 at 7:17 pm #1713074On the JMT I wouldn't (and haven't) treated any water. It is entirely possible to only drink water up high from above where most people camp and from visibly melting snow. Even if you want to treat your water, you should repackage your water treatment chemicals in 0.5 fl oz eye dropper bottles, easily can last your JMT trip.
My suggestion would be to get a 20 oz. o.j. bottle and keep it either in your hand or easily accessible in a side pocket. See water, fill, drink, refill, drink again over the next 15 minutes. No need to carry any water longer than 20 minutes for most of the JMT.
I can't imagine needing down pants in the summer. I only carry rain pants and the shorts I hike in and am plenty warm.
Unless you're going with a significant other there is absolutely no reason to wash underwear or socks more than every 3-4 days and no need for extra undies. Same goes for t-shirt.
